CDL Entry Level Driver Training (ELDT) – Hazmat and Tank Vehicle (X) Endorsement Course Syllabus

This CDL Entry Level Driver Training (ELDT) – X Endorsement course consists of 14 lessons divided into 5 modules. Students must complete each lesson in the order listed below.

Lessons

Introduction

Module 1: Hazmat Basic Requirements and Communication

This module sets the stage for understanding the rules and regulations governing hazardous materials transportation. Students will learn foundational hazardous materials competencies and applicable DOT HMR and FMCSR regulatory requirements, including the hazardous materials table, proper marking, labeling, and placarding of cargo, and the preparation and importance of shipping papers. This module also explains how to identify appropriate reporting channels during hazardous materials emergencies.

  • Lesson 1: Basic Introductory Hazardous Materials Requirements
  • Lesson 2: Operational Hazardous Materials Requirements
  • Lesson 3: Reporting Hazardous Materials Crashes and Releases

Module 2: Safe Transportation Practices

This module introduces practical procedures for safely transporting hazardous materials. Students will learn regulations related to tunnels and railroad crossings, proper loading and unloading techniques, cargo segregation and securement, and requirements for transporting hazardous materials alongside foodstuffs. Specialized considerations for bulk packages, including cargo tanks and portable tanks, are also covered.

  • Lesson 4: Tunnels and Railroad (RR)-Highway Grade Crossing Requirements
  • Lesson 5: Loading and Unloading Hazardous Materials
  • Lesson 6: Hazardous Materials on Passenger Vehicles
  • Lesson 7: Bulk Packages
  • Lesson 8: Tank Vehicles Operation and Inspection

Module 3: Emergency Preparedness and Response

Being prepared for emergencies is critical when transporting hazardous materials. This module focuses on accident response and unintended hazardous materials releases. Students will learn proper reporting procedures and best practices for emergency response to protect people, property, and the environment.

  • Lesson 9: Operating Emergency Equipment
  • Lesson 10: Emergency Response Procedures

Module 4: Pre-Trip and Operational Considerations

Module 4 emphasizes pre-trip inspections and operational safety. Students will learn proper procedures for checking vehicle tires before each trip and understand critical FMCSA regulations related to fueling while transporting hazardous materials.

  • Lesson 11: Engine (Fueling)
  • Lesson 12: Tire Check

Module 5: Planning and Permits

This module focuses on trip planning and regulatory preparation before transporting hazardous materials. Students will learn route planning requirements, how to select compliant routes, and when a Hazardous Materials Safety Permit (HMSP) is required. The module also covers operational procedures for transporting hazardous materials under an HMSP to ensure safety and compliance.

  • Lesson 13: Routes and Route Planning
  • Lesson 14: Hazardous Materials Safety Permits (HMSP)
